ArcelorMittal issues bond amid energy pressure

In:
Metals and Mining
Region:
Americas, Asia-Pacific, Europe

The uphill battle facing Luxembourg-based ArcelorMittal was reflected by it starting out offering a yield equivalent to 5% for four-year money as steel producers grapple with weakening demand and soaring energy prices. The Baa3/BBB- issuer opened proceedings on a four-year euro benchmark at 240bp...
